Are you stuck for ways to stretch your best English students?

By focusing on what excites and motivates all learners, this book provides you with a clear guide to ensuring sound provision for your gifted and talented students.

Included is advice on:

ohow to identify more able students

owhat to do to get other staff on board

osuccessful strategies for working with more able students

ousing ICT effectively in lessons and activities

ohow to measure students' progress

opersonalised learning

There is an accompanying CD which contains photocopiable material which will help you plan your lessons and departmental strategy.
